My 73 has the stock front bumper brackets slid back and 72 rear bumper brackets. The bumpers are replaced with those which have no slots.

The 72 rear bracket pulls the bumper in like the 70-71. Mine still has the original 73 front brackets that were on the car when it was stock. The rear bumperets fit as well. Everything fits. I also put a 70 grille in it. But that takes a bit of fab work.

The 70-72 bumper brackets are the same. 70-72 bumpers have the same profile but in late 71, they added the jack slots.

73 rear bumper brackets are a one year only deal. They look like the Cuda style brackets. They are a stamped metal part...not just bar stock.

74 rear bumper brackets are a one year only deal. They went back to a bar stock bracket.

I believe(not100%)that 73 and 74 front brackets are the same.

73 and 74 bumpers have a different profile then 70-72. Try mounting a 73-74 bumper guard on a 70-72 bumper and you will see the difference. 73-74 had thick/heavy metal reinforcement plates behind the bumpers.(front and rear)

I don't believe any E-body ever came with a shock absorber style mount.
